Nifty below 21,750 mark, oil & gas shares slip

Published on Dec 29, 2023 10:37

The benchmark indices traded with limited losses in the morning trade. The Nifty traded below the 21,750 mark. Oil & gas shares declined after advancing in the past trading session.

At 10:30 IST, the barometer index, the S&P BSE Sensex, was down 217.99 points or 0.30% to 72,192.39. The Nifty 50 index lost 65.80 points or 0.30% to 21,712.90.

The broader market outperformed the headline indices. The S&P BSE Mid-Cap index added 0.14% and the S&P BSE Small-Cap index gained 0.25%.

The market breadth was positive. On the BSE, 1,856 shares rose and 1,587 shares fell. A total of 174 shares were unchanged.

New Listing:

Shares of Innova Captab were currently trading at Rs 502.40 at 10:23 IST on the BSE, representing a premium of 12.14% as compared with the issue price of Rs 448.

The scrip was listed at Rs 456.10, exhibiting a premium of 1.81% to the issue price.

So far, the stock has hit a high of 521 and a low of 452. On the BSE, over 8.12 lakh shares of the company were traded in the counter so far.

Buzzing Index:

The Nifty Oil & Gas index fell 0.93% to 9,499.75. The index advanced 2.01% in the past trading session.

Hindustan Petroleum Corporation (down 3.76%), Bharat Petroleum Corporation (down 2.66%), Indian Oil Corporation (down 2.29%), Oil India (down 1.75%), Oil & Natural Gas Corpn (down 1.13%) Reliance Industries (down 0.82%), Castrol India (down 0.67%), Gujarat State Petronet (down 0.34%), Adani Total Gas (down 0.01%) declined.

On the other hand, GAIL (India) (up 2.39%), Mahanagar Gas (up 0.8%) and Indraprastha Gas (up 0.53%) advanced.

Stocks in Spotlight:

Federal Bank rose 0.58%. The private lender said that it has received intimation from the Reserve Bank of India that it has accorded its approval to ICICI Prudential Asset Management Company Ltd. (ICICI AMC) for acquiring aggregate holding of up to 9.95% of the paidup Share Capital or Voting Rights of the Bank.

RailTel Corporation of India rallied 3.42% after the company received the work order amounting to Rs. 120.45 crore (Including GST) from South Central Railway for comprehensive signalling and telecommunication works for provision of automatic block signalling system in Yermaras-Nalwar section of Guntakal division in South Central Railway.

Satin Creditcare Network rose 0.33%. The company has entered into master Agreement for co-lending of loans to Micro-Finance Borrowers by way of Co-Lending Module in tranches with Karnataka Bank.
